    Heart of the Confused

    Can anyone tell me why Riku went bad?
    I still don't uderstand the whole Riku being controlled by whats his name thing.

    Also, I still don't understand the whole Kairi's heart is Sora's heart thing either.
    Does anyone have a clue what that's about?
    Please tell me, because my brain is going to explode with all of this confusion.

    Maleficent convinced Riku she'd help him find Kairi. She convinced him that by allowing his inner darkness to grow, he'd become powerful enough to save Kairi.
    Because Riku let Maleficent manipulate him into allowing his darkness to grow, that darkness became the strings by which the spirit of Ansem could control him.

    When the door at Destiny Islands was opened, Kairi was blasted passed Sora. As this occurred, her heart separated from her body. However, because of the unusually strong bond between Sora and Kairi, her heart was able to rest within his until the moment when it and her body were reunited.

    Mercen-X is right, but before Malificent had any influence over Riku, Riku went bad, kind of. Riku was desperate, he would do anything to get off of the Destiny Islands. Anything, including following the darkness in his heart. He wasn't afraid of it, he accepted it as a viable way of things. As he did that, the keyblade chose Sora instead of Riku. When he was desperate to find and rescue Kairi, he again followed the darkness in his heart, and it slowly began to twist and consume him (Episode III anyone? ), until Ansem finally convinced him to give into the darkness completely, allowing Ansem to take over his body. When he was in the Hallow Bastion, and he had found Kairi and he knew how to potentially save her, he for once saw the light, and that light allowed him to take control of the keyblade that would have been his in the first place. But when Sora showed the keyblade the pureness and strength of his heart, it overpowered Riku's heart, even if only for an instant, which is all he needed.

    Kairi's heart with Sora? Call it the effects of the paopu (sp?) fruit (at least that's what the reference to that fruit is suppose to signify). It's also possible that the keyblade, or the power of the keyblade master, had something to do with it. Who knows. But fact of the matter, Kairi flew into Sora and then vanished, so what Mercen-X said.
